摘要:,,本文探讨了凤凰网新闻爬虫的设计与应用的探讨。文章介绍了新闻爬虫的基本概念和工作原理,分析了凤凰网新闻爬虫的设计要点,包括数据抓取、数据存储、数据分析等方面。文章还探讨了新闻爬虫的应用场景,如数据挖掘、舆情分析、新闻报道等。文章总结了凤凰网新闻爬虫的应用价值和发展前景,强调了其在信息获取和分析领域的重要性。
本文目录导读:
随着互联网技术的飞速发展,新闻信息的获取和传播方式发生了巨大的变化,新闻爬虫作为一种自动化获取网络新闻信息的技术手段,被广泛应用于新闻报道、舆情分析等领域,凤凰网作为国内知名的新闻网站,其新闻爬虫的设计显得尤为重要,本文将探讨凤凰网新闻爬虫的设计思路、技术要点以及应用前景。
凤凰网新闻爬虫的设计思路
1、数据需求分析
设计新闻爬虫的首要任务是明确数据需求,凤凰网新闻内容丰富,涵盖了政治、经济、社会、娱乐等多个领域,需要对不同领域的新闻数据进行抓取,考虑到新闻时效性和更新频率,爬虫需要定时抓取最新新闻数据。
2、数据源选择
数据源的选择直接影响到新闻爬虫的性能和效果,凤凰网新闻爬虫的数据源主要是凤凰网的新闻页面,为了获取高质量的新闻数据,需要对数据源进行筛选和预处理,去除广告、无用链接等干扰信息。
3、爬虫架构设计
凤凰网新闻爬虫架构包括数据抓取、数据存储、数据分析三个核心模块,数据抓取模块负责从凤凰网获取新闻数据;数据存储模块负责将抓取到的数据存储到本地或云端;数据分析模块则对存储的数据进行处理和分析,提取有价值的信息。
4、技术选型
在设计凤凰网新闻爬虫时,需要选择合适的技术和工具,如Python的Scrapy框架,适用于爬取结构化的网页数据;对于动态加载的网页内容,可以使用Selenium等工具模拟浏览器行为;对于数据存储,可以选择关系型数据库如MySQL或NoSQL数据库如MongoDB等。
技术要点
1、数据抓取
数据抓取是新闻爬虫的核心环节,针对凤凰网新闻页面的特点,需要设计合理的爬虫策略,如设置合适的爬取深度、处理反爬虫机制等,为了提高抓取效率,需要实现多线程或分布式抓取。
2、数据清洗与处理
抓取到的新闻数据需要进行清洗和处理,去除无关信息,提取关键信息,如标题、时间、来源、内容等,还需要对文本数据进行分词、去停用词等预处理,以便后续的分析和挖掘。
3、数据存储
数据存储是保障新闻数据可用性的关键环节,设计合理的存储方案,如使用数据库或分布式存储系统,确保新闻数据的持久性和可访问性。
应用前景
凤凰网新闻爬虫的设计对于新闻报道、舆情分析等领域具有重要意义,通过自动化获取新闻数据,可以实现对新闻事件的实时监测和报道;通过对抓取到的数据进行深入分析,可以挖掘出有价值的舆情信息,为决策提供支持,随着人工智能技术的发展,凤凰网新闻爬虫有望在自然语言处理、智能推荐等领域发挥更大的作用。
本文探讨了凤凰网新闻爬虫的设计思路、技术要点以及应用前景,设计新闻爬虫需要明确数据需求、选择合适的数据源和技术工具,并关注数据抓取、清洗、存储等关键环节,凤凰网新闻爬虫有望在新闻报道、舆情分析等领域发挥更大的作用,为社会发展做出贡献。
还没有评论,来说两句吧...